Smalltalk
Smalltalk was the very first Object Oriented programming
language. Originally developed in Xerox PARC, Smalltalk pioneered the ideas used
in modern window systems and modern programming languages. Even to this day the
Smalltalk language and the programming environment are far beyond anything
available in any other language. Smalltalk delivers platform independence,
automatic garbage collection, dynamic compilation (just in time compiling), a
powerful meta-programming environment, and a fully integrated development and
debugging environment.
